Output 26726baf53fbfcc4a3b3b0228f1cdd6e859d171fc5401d3d1b20973efef9f4c6:0

value
160660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8cd86da65cde9c76c05bc01f5786fca195c33f3 OP_EQUAL
address
3NuxuJHDGjmrcypuZmzyPhggXCJiXF77Le
transaction
26726baf53fbfcc4a3b3b0228f1cdd6e859d171fc5401d3d1b20973efef9f4c6
spent
true